#c7bb72 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#c7bb72 is composed of 78% red, 73.3%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6% magenta, 42.7%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 51.5 degrees, a saturation of 43.1% and a lightness of 61.4%. #c7bb72 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e4 with #8f7700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

● #c7bb72 color description : Slightly desaturated yellow.
The hexadecimal color #c7bb72 has RGB values of R:199, G:187,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.06, Y:0.43,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13089650.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0c05 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.
